Listing Description

This unique mixed-use building offers 6100sqft of total space, with retail/commercial on the main and lower levels, and a fully-renovated 2100sqft upstairs apartment. Located in Allendale, across from the park and school. The 2060sqft main floor offers wide-open retail space with large front-facing windows, plus a full kitchen and storage, with new flooring and finishes throughout. Can be split into two spaces if desired. The 1940sqft basement offers additional retail/office space with its own storefront entrance. Upstairs youll find a renovated apartment with 2 bedrooms, 2 dens/offices and 2 full baths, plus a raised deck and multiple skylights. The kitchen and living areas offer huge windows and high-end modern finishes. Outside is a private, fenced back yard, plus parking in front and behind the building. Recent upgrades (2016): full renovations to main floor and apartment, new roof and all new heating system on all 3 levels. 400A electrical, separately metered. CN zoning allows for a variety of uses.
